A loyalist observer once remarked of Johnston that Independence seems to be his favorite Scheme3 He was appointed to the Loudoun County Committee of Correspondence on June 14, 1774,4often serving as the bodys clerk.5 With the outbreak of armed conflict the following year, however, Johnston took up arms and was appointed a Captain in the 2nd Virginia Regiment on September 21, 1775.6 The unit spent the following year screening and skirmishing with crown military forces in the southern Tidewater region of Virginia and Johnston fought with his company at the Battle of Great Bridge on December 9, 1775.7, Due to his seniority and good standing, George Johnston was promoted to the rank of Major of the 5th Virginia Regiment on August 13, 1776, as the Virginia Line of the Continental Army grew.8 He joined his regiment in Pennsylvania several weeks later and, early in the morning of December 26, 1776, crossed the Delaware River with the Commander-in-Chief to rout the Hessian garrison at Trenton, New Jersey.9 With the departure of an aide in early January 1777, George Washington queried his military secretary, Robert Hanson Harrison, if Majr Johnston would not, in your opinion, make a good Aid de Camp to me?.. noted Hemsley spent ten years as George Jefferson on.
